I have to type domain name\user name to log in to my FTP
server. How can I get rid of the domain name? How can I
set the default domail name so users don't have to type
it when log on?

Here you go,
FTP Service's DefaultLogonDomain Not Available in MMC
http://support.microsoft.com/?id=184319
